Geert Vermeersch - monologue "Bernard" Theatre

Geert Vermeersch - monologue "Bernard"

Fri, 16 Oct 2026 · 20:00
Kasteel Ter Borcht, Meulebeke
Sometimes one man tells a story in which everyone recognizes themselves. With BERNARD, Geert Vermeersch presents a moving and tragicomic monologue about an ordinary man who looks back on life from a bench. Between sharp humor, quiet melancholy, and recognizable musings, the portrait of a quirky, stubborn, but above all warm personality unfolds. Bernard writes letters to his sister and lets the audience become a participant in his memories, doubts, and dreams. His story touches on universal themes such as loneliness, love, loss, hope, and the small moments that give a human life color. Geert Vermeersch gives shape to Bernard in an impressive way. With subtle acting and great emotional honesty, he takes the audience on a journey that is simultaneously funny, moving, and recognizable. The text by Piet Van Compernolle excels in sharp observations, poetic simplicity, and a deeply human heart. BERNARD is a performance that moves without becoming sentimental, that makes one smile and also makes one quiet. An intimate theater experience that lingers long after the curtain has fallen.
